Comets can appear in a variety of colors, including white, blue, green, yellow, and red. The color of a comet is determined by the types of gases and dust particles it releases as it travels through space. Different elements in these materials can produce different colors when they interact with sunlight. Additionally, the distance of the comet from the sun and the temperature of its environment can also affect its coloration.

The different colors in moths are primarily caused by variations in their genetic makeup, which influence pigment production and structural coloration. Environmental factors, such as habitat type and light conditions, can also impact coloration, as moths may adapt their coloration for camouflage against predators or to attract mates. Additionally, evolutionary pressures, such as natural selection, play a significant role in shaping these color variations over time.
The color of granite is primarily determined by the presence of mineral crystals such as feldspar, quartz, and mica. The composition and concentration of these minerals contribute to the various colors and patterns seen in granite rocks. Additional minerals like hornblende and amphibole can also influence the coloration of granite.

Not always. While some minerals do get their color from specific elements in their chemical composition, others can be influenced by impurities or defects in their crystal structure. Additionally, physical and environmental factors can also alter a mineral's color.
